Subject: | The name is very confusing |
Calling this "Moo::Google" when it is built on _Moose_ instead of _Moo_ is very confusing. That said, naming things after what they're built on is not a good practice. It's much better if the name describes what it does rather than what it is made of. So with that in mind maybe it's best to call it something like "WebService::Google::Base" or something along those lines.